What is Gratuity?
A Gratuity Calculator helps employees estimate the lump-sum amount they may receive from their employer when leaving a job, provided they meet the eligibility conditions. Gratuity is a financial benefit given by employers as a reward for long-term service.
It is commonly applicable to employees who have worked with the same organization for at least 5 years.
How Gratuity Works
Gratuity is calculated based on the last drawn salary (usually Basic + Dearness Allowance) and the total years of service. If remaining months of service are 6 or more, the year is rounded up.
Eligibility After 5 Years
Employees qualify after 5 years of continuous service (4.5+ years rounds up)
Last Drawn Salary Based
Calculated on Basic + Dearness Allowance at the time of leaving
One-Time Lump Sum
Paid as a single payment upon leaving the company
